P1405 Cleared twice and came back????

Where do I start with rectifying this sitiuation?

Print out from Autozone

Definition:

DPFE sensor upstream hose off or plugged

Explanation:

ECM detected EGR flow in a negative direction no EGR flow commanded

Probable Causes:

1.Failed DPFE sensor (EGR pressure sensor)
2.Open or shorted circuit condition
3.Plugged or damaged EGR tube

Well I figured it out. the hose on the right has a crack in it gunna switch it out tomarrow and reset the code. I changed that sensor back in 03. when it went out i got like 100 miles to the tank of gas, was crazy.
